Aluminium-Polyester

The aluminium-polyester laminate (AL/PET) combines the electrical conductivity of aluminium with the mechanical strength of polyester film, bonded with an oven post-cured polyurethane adhesive. This structure delivers effective electromagnetic shields without compromising material integrity during high-speed taping or throughout the cable's service life.

In data-cable construction, AL/PET is applied as an individual shield over each twisted pair or as an overall shield over the bundle, providing attenuation against electromagnetic (EMI) and radio-frequency (RFI) interference. The polyester layer adds dimensional stability and tensile strength, while the aluminium — facing the cable core and in contact with the drain wire — ensures the electrical continuity of the shield.

Structures range from 9/12 µm (24 µm total) to 50/23 µm (76 µm total), with tensile strength of 75 to 110 MPa depending on configuration. This range allows the optimal balance between shielding level, finished-cable flexibility and behaviour during manufacturing to be selected.

Aluminium thickness directly drives shielding effectiveness: greater thickness means greater interference attenuation. However, high aluminium thicknesses reduce laminate flexibility and increase the risk of cracking during folding. The optimum selection depends on the cable type and the expected installation conditions.

For high-speed extrusion processes, lubricated (LUB) versions are available, reducing friction on the aluminium face by up to 50 %, lowering tool wear and improving process stability.

Selection guide

How to choose the right one?

Selecting the right structure depends on the balance between required shielding level, finished-cable flexibility and behaviour during taping. Thinner gauges offer greater flexibility, while thicker ones provide better EMI attenuation.

Structure (Al/PET) Total thickness Weight Tensile strength Elongation Typical application When to choose
9/12 24 µm 44.0 g/m² 90 MPa 30% LAN Cat5/Cat5e cables Maximum flexibility, basic shielding
9/15 27 µm 48.2 g/m² 100 MPa 30% Pair, instrumentation cables Flexibility/strength balance
9/23 35 µm 59.3 g/m² 110 MPa 30% Data and signal cables Greater mechanical support
12/12 27 µm 52.0 g/m² 75 MPa 15% Cat6 cables Improved shielding, high flexibility
12/19 34 µm 62.0 g/m² 100 MPa 30% High-speed data cables General use, good behaviour
25/23 51 µm 102.3 g/m² 95 MPa 20% Cat6A/Cat7 cables High shielding, demanding environments
25/50 77 µm 138.2 g/m² 90 MPa 20% Overall shield, coaxial cables Maximum mechanical support
40/23 66 µm 143.1 g/m² 80 MPa 15% Industrial cables Elevated shielding

Additional structures available on request: 12/15, 12/23, 15/19, 37/12, 37/23, 40/12, 50/12, 50/23.

Technical data

Technical specifications

The mechanical values shown below come from tests run to ASTM standards and characterise the material's behaviour both during processing and in service.

Property Method 9/12 9/15 9/23 12/12 12/19 25/23 25/50 40/23
Al thickness (µm) ASTM D374 9 9 9 12 12 25 25 40
PET thickness (µm) ASTM D374 12 15 23 12 19 23 50 23
Total thickness (µm, ±10%) ASTM D374 24 27 35 27 34 51 77 66
Weight (g/m²) 44.0 48.2 59.3 52.0 62.0 102.3 138.2 143.1
Tensile strength (MPa) ASTM D882 90 100 110 75 100 95 90 80
Elongation at break (%) ASTM D882 30 30 30 15 30 20 20 15

Values shown are typical and do not constitute binding specifications.

Customization

Available variants

Laminate configuration

  • Simplex (AL/PET) — aluminium on one side, standard
  • Triplex (AL/PET/AL) — aluminium on both sides, maximum shielding

Surface treatments

  • Natural — standard
  • Lubricated (LUB) — up to 50% friction reduction on aluminium face, ideal for high-speed extrusion

Colours

  • Neutral — standard
  • Custom colours on request — by changing the adhesive, for construction identification
Supply

Delivery formats

The supply format directly influences process continuity and taping efficiency. Material can be supplied in different formats and dimensions adapted to each machine type and production speed.

Pad / Roll (pancake)

Flat reel for conventional taping

Core ID 76 mm (3″), 102 mm (4″), 152 mm (6″)
Max OD 80 – 600 mm
Width range 5 – 1000 mm
Core material Plastic or cardboard

Spool (TWS / STS reel)

Reel for feeding taping machines

Core ID 76 mm (3″)
Max OD 300 – 320 mm
Width range 3.5 – 80 mm
Winding type Traverse Wounded (TWS) or Step to Step (STS)
Core material Plastic or cardboard

Other formats and dimensions available on request. Custom slitting service available.
